What is Heart Block?
Heart block, a condition related to the heart’s electrical conduction system, occurs when the electrical signals that coordinate the heart’s beats are delayed or completely blocked. This disruption in the normal functioning of the heart can lead to an irregular heartbeat, known medically as arrhythmia. The electrical signals are essential for maintaining an appropriate heart rhythm, ensuring that the heart beats in a synchronized and effective manner. When these signals are impaired, it can result in various symptoms and complications.
The heart’s electrical conduction system consists of specialized tissues responsible for generating and transmitting electrical impulses. These impulses initiate each heartbeat, starting from the sinoatrial (SA) node, often referred to as the heart’s natural pacemaker. The electrical signal travels from the SA node to the atrioventricular (AV) node, and subsequently through the bundle of His and Purkinje fibers, ultimately resulting in the contraction of the heart muscles. Heart block can occur at different levels within this conduction system, leading to different types of block.
There are three main degrees of heart block: first-degree, second-degree, and third-degree. First-degree heart block is the least severe type, characterized by a prolonged delay in the conduction of electrical signals. Second-degree heart block is more serious, as it involves intermittent failures in signal transmission. Third-degree heart block, or complete heart block, presents a significant health risk, where signals fail to reach the ventricles altogether, potentially leading to life-threatening complications.
Understanding heart block is crucial for recognizing its impact on overall heart function and health. The delay or blockage of electrical signals can hinder the heart’s ability to pump blood effectively, which can result in symptoms such as fatigue, dizziness, and fainting spells. Proper diagnosis and treatment of heart block are essential to mitigate these risks and promote a healthy heart rhythm.
Types of Heart Block
Heart block is a condition that affects the heart’s electrical conduction system, leading to potential disruptions in heart rhythms and function. There are several distinct types of heart block, categorized mainly by their severity and the specific nature of the conduction pathway affected. Understanding these types is crucial for effective diagnosis and treatment.
The first type, known as first-degree heart block, is characterized by a delay in the conduction of electrical impulses through the heart. In this condition, each electrical impulse from the atria is eventually conducted to the ventricles, but the time taken is longer than normal. While first-degree heart block is often asymptomatic and may not require treatment, it can indicate an underlying heart condition that requires monitoring.
Second-degree heart block is divided into two categories: Mobitz type I (Wenckebach) and Mobitz type II. Mobitz type I is characterized by a progressive lengthening of the PR interval on an electrocardiogram (ECG) until an impulse fails to make it to the ventricles, causing a dropped beat. This form is generally considered less serious and often does not require treatment, although regular monitoring is essential. In contrast, Mobitz type II is characterized by a consistent PR interval followed by sudden, unpredictable drops in beats. This more serious form may necessitate the use of a pacemaker, as it poses a higher risk of progression to complete blockage.
Finally, third-degree heart block, also referred to as complete heart block, is the most severe type. In this condition, there is a total failure of electrical communication between the atria and ventricles. As a result, the atria and ventricles beat independently of one another, leading to significantly reduced heart function and potential symptoms of fatigue or fainting. This type of heart block typically requires immediate medical intervention, often in the form of a permanent pacemaker to restore normal heart rhythms and ensure adequate blood circulation.
Causes of Heart Block
Heart block is a condition characterized by an interruption or delay in the electrical signals that coordinate the heart’s beating. Understanding the causes of heart block is crucial in addressing this potentially serious condition. Various medical conditions and lifestyle factors can contribute to the development of heart block, and these can be broadly categorized into congenital issues, coronary artery disease, heart valve problems, medications, electrolyte imbalances, and lifestyle choices.
Congenital conditions are one significant category associated with heart block. Some individuals are born with structural abnormalities in their heart’s electrical system, leading to heart block from an early age. Additionally, coronary artery disease (CAD) can lead to heart block by reducing blood flow to the heart muscle, compromising its function and electrical conduction. As the coronary arteries narrow due to plaque buildup, the likelihood of experiencing heart block increases.
Heart valve diseases can also contribute to heart block. Conditions that affect the heart valves, such as aortic stenosis or mitral valve prolapse, can disrupt the flow of blood and affect the heart’s electrical activity, resulting in heart block. In some cases, external factors such as certain medications, including beta-blockers and calcium channel blockers, can interfere with the heart’s conduction system. Electrolyte imbalances, particularly involving potassium and calcium levels, may also affect the heart’s ability to conduct electrical signals properly.
Lastly, lifestyle factors cannot be overlooked. Excessive alcohol consumption, substance abuse, and a sedentary lifestyle can increase the risk of heart disease and consequently contribute to the likelihood of developing heart block. By identifying these causes, individuals and healthcare providers can take proactive steps to manage the underlying conditions that may lead to heart block, thereby improving overall heart health.
Symptoms of Heart Block
Heart block is a condition that affects the electrical signals in the heart, leading to a disruption in its normal rhythm. The symptoms associated with heart block can vary significantly based on the severity of the condition and the level of blockage present. Understanding these symptoms is crucial for timely intervention and treatment.
One of the most common symptoms experienced by individuals with heart block is fatigue. Patients often report feeling unusually tired or exhausted, even with minimal physical exertion. This fatigue can be attributed to the heart’s inefficiency in pumping adequate blood to meet the body’s demands. Another prevalent symptom is dizziness, which may occur due to intermittent drops in blood flow to the brain as the heart struggles to maintain a regular rhythm.
Palpitations, which are sensations of rapid or fluttering heartbeats, are also frequently encountered. These may occur when the heart attempts to compensate for the disruption in electrical signaling. Individuals may notice their heart racing or beating in an irregular pattern. In more severe instances of heart block, syncope, or fainting, can occur. This happens when the brain lacks sufficient blood flow for a brief period, potentially leading to a loss of consciousness.
It is important to note that the manifestation of these symptoms can differ widely among individuals and may not always correlate directly with the severity of the heart block. Some patients may experience only mild symptoms, while others may endure significant distress. As such, any unusual heart-related symptoms should prompt immediate medical attention. Early evaluation and diagnosis can help manage the symptoms effectively and facilitate appropriate treatment, preventing potential complications associated with heart block.
Diagnosis of Heart Block
The diagnosis of heart block involves a multifaceted approach that combines patient history, physical examination, and various diagnostic tests. Healthcare professionals begin with a thorough medical history, focusing on any symptoms a patient may be experiencing, such as fatigue, dizziness, or palpitations. The physical examination often includes listening to the heart for irregular rhythms or abnormal beats, which can provide initial clues about the presence of heart block.
One of the primary tools for diagnosing heart block is the electrocardiogram (ECG), a test that records the electrical activity of the heart. An ECG can reveal the type and severity of heart block by displaying how well electrical signals are traveling through the heart’s conduction system. There are three main types of heart block: first-degree, second-degree (which can be further divided into type 1 and type 2), and third-degree heart block. Each type has distinct patterns that can be identified on an ECG.
In some cases, a standard ECG may not capture intermittent heart block episodes. Therefore, healthcare providers may utilize Holter monitors, which are portable ECG devices that patients wear for 24 to 48 hours. This extended monitoring period allows for the detection of transient abnormalities that may not occur during a standard test. Additionally, event monitors may be used for longer-term monitoring, which can help correlate symptoms to electrical disturbances.
Other cardiac imaging techniques, such as echocardiograms or stress tests, may also be employed to assess overall heart function and to rule out other potential issues that could contribute to symptoms. Ultimately, a combination of these diagnostic approaches enables healthcare professionals to accurately determine the presence, type, and severity of heart block, guiding appropriate treatment decisions.
Treatment Options for Heart Block
Heart block is a condition affecting the electrical signals in the heart, leading to various degrees of impairment in heart function. The treatment approach for heart block depends on its severity and the specific symptoms presented by the patient. Early-stage heart block may necessitate minimal intervention, while more severe forms might require comprehensive medical management or surgical options.
One of the primary treatment methods involves lifestyle modifications. Patients are often advised to adopt a heart-healthy diet, engage in regular physical activity, and manage stress effectively. Quitting smoking and limiting alcohol intake can also play a crucial role in enhancing heart health. These changes can potentially help in alleviating symptoms and improving overall well-being in individuals with mild heart block.
Additionally, the use of medications is common in managing heart block. Doctors may prescribe medications such as beta-blockers, which can help regulate heart rhythm and manage any underlying conditions contributing to the block. In cases where heart block is symptomatic or progressive, pharmacological treatment becomes essential to ensure adequate heart function and reduce complications.
In more severe instances of heart block, particularly when patients experience significant symptoms such as syncope or severe bradycardia, the implantation of a pacemaker may be warranted. A pacemaker is a small device implanted under the skin, designed to help maintain an appropriate heart rate and rhythm by sending electrical impulses to the heart as needed. This intervention not only alleviates symptoms but also significantly enhances the quality of life and prognosis for patients diagnosed with advanced heart block.
Ultimately, the treatment strategy is tailored based on individual patient needs and the specific type of heart block diagnosed. Ongoing monitoring and follow-up care are essential components, ensuring any evolving issues are addressed promptly to optimize heart health.
Risk Factors and Prevention Strategies
Heart block is a condition characterized by the interruption of electrical signals in the heart, which can lead to significant health complications. Various risk factors contribute to the development of heart block, necessitating an understanding of both intrinsic and extrinsic elements. Age is a primary risk factor; older adults are more susceptible due to natural wear and tear on the cardiovascular system. The prevalence of heart block tends to increase with advancing age, making regular cardiovascular assessments critical for those over 60.
Pre-existing heart conditions also significantly elevate the risk of heart block. Patients diagnosed with coronary artery disease, cardiomyopathy, or valvular heart disease should be particularly vigilant. Additionally, individuals who have previously undergone heart surgery or have implantable devices, such as pacemakers, may experience an increased likelihood of developing this condition. However, heart block can also occur in seemingly healthy individuals, which emphasizes the importance of routine health check-ups.
Lifestyle choices play a vital role in influencing heart health. Poor dietary habits, such as excessive intake of saturated fats, sugars, and processed foods, can contribute to heart disease, indirectly raising the risk of heart block. Maintaining a heart-healthy diet rich in fruits, vegetables, whole grains, and lean proteins is essential. Regular physical activity can also lower the risk, as it enhances cardiovascular endurance and reduces the likelihood of hypertension, another significant contributor to heart conditions.
Moreover, effective management of blood pressure is crucial in preventing heart block. Individuals are encouraged to monitor their blood pressure regularly and implement stress-reduction techniques when necessary. Avoiding smoking and limiting alcohol intake are additional preventive strategies that can improve overall heart health. By addressing these risk factors through targeted lifestyle modifications, individuals can significantly reduce their chances of developing heart block and promote a healthier cardiovascular system.

When to Seek Medical Help
Heart block is a condition that affects the electrical signals in the heart, impacting its ability to function effectively. Recognizing when to seek medical attention is crucial for individuals experiencing symptoms associated with this issue. It is vital for patients and their families to be aware of the warning signs that may indicate a worsening of the condition or complications requiring immediate care.
Individuals should seek medical help if they experience sudden dizziness, severe fatigue, or unexplained shortness of breath. These symptoms can signify that the heart is not pumping adequately due to blockages in the electrical conduction system. Additionally, episodes of fainting or near-fainting should not be overlooked, as they may point to significant heart block that could be detrimental to a person’s health.
Chest pain is another critical symptom that warrants prompt medical evaluation. While it may not always be directly linked to heart block, it can indicate underlying heart issues that require immediate attention. Patients and their families should maintain a proactive approach to health management, keeping track of any changes in symptoms and ensuring regular follow-ups with healthcare providers.
For those diagnosed with heart block, it’s essential to understand that some forms can lead to life-threatening complications, such as complete heart block. This condition may necessitate interventions like pacemaker implantation. Therefore, any significant increase in symptoms or new concerning signs should prompt an urgent consultation with a healthcare professional.
